I'll take some pictures as soon as I can. Here's what you need:
6 M4 Hyper White: License plate (1), trunk (1), side markers (2), and parking lamps (2)
2 M2 Hyper White: Back up lights (2) and turn signals (2 if you want white turn signals)
2 M16 Hyper White: Map/interior (these are sold in a pair, so you need only one pair)
2 M60 Miracle White H1: High beam halogen ( near perfect match for the HID color) (These are sold in a pair, so you need only one pair)

I don't think photos will help you much. Just imagine all the lights putting out light the color of the HIDS -- a very pure white that doesn't have a yellow hue. The bulbs are coated with a blue film or dye of some kind, which must filter the yellow out of the light, but they don't look blue when their lit.
